We are introducing a Japanese Kakejiku tailoring service for your finished embroidery. Kakejiku is a Japanese hanging scroll used to display and exhibit embroidery, paintings and calligraphy inscriptions and designs mounted usually with silk fabric edges on a flexible backing so that it can be rolled for storage. This item is made by the artisans in Japan which JEC and Kurenai-kai, Japan have been collaborating for several decades. They have tremendous knowledge as to how to treat and mount embroidery to washi and silk fabric and which mat fabric type matches your embroidery.
